Roland Hanna was born on February 10, 1932 in Detroit, Michigan, USA as Roland Pembroke Hanna. He is known for his work on Malcolm X (1992), Jungle Fever (1991) and Asphalt Girl (1964). He was married to Ramona Woodard. He died on November 13, 2002 in Hackensack, New Jersey, USA.

Recorded new accompaniments to Charlie Parker's solos for Clint Eastwood's "Bird".

Considered one of the leading exponents of the so-called Detroit school of jazz piano.

Hanna was knighted in 1970 by the government of Liberia, in recognition of benefit concerts he had performed in the African nation. Thereafter, he insisted on being billed as "Sir Roland Hanna."
